Yes this works too, be careful not to point the heat gun at one spot for too long. Go back and forth and keep the gun moving at all times or else you'll just melt the crap out of it. I've done it, probably takes as much time as the oven, just a bit more work cause you don't just leave it in the oven and let it sit for 20 minutes.

I'm not so sure a heat gun would work. when you get one part melted enough, the otherside would still be too cold to pull the headlight together. the heat needs to be distributed evenly. theres way too much glue on the lexus headlights. it's a lot better to do it in the oven. baking isnt that dangerous or risky... it just sounds bad.
